Toilet Valve Replacement in Denver, CO
Toilet valve replacement services involve removing and installing new valves within a toilet to ensure proper water flow and prevent leaks. This service covers a range of projects, including replacing faulty or worn-out fill valves, flush valves, or other internal components that control water movement. Homeowners often request this service when experiencing continuous running toilets, inconsistent flushing, or water wastage, aiming to restore efficient operation and conserve water.
Before requesting toilet valve replacement, property owners typically want to understand the scope of work involved, the type of valves suitable for their toilet models, and any potential disruptions during the process. It's also common to inquire about the signs indicating a valve needs replacement, such as frequent leaks, difficulty flushing, or unusual noises. Having a clear understanding of these factors can help ensure the replacement addresses the specific issues and maintains the toilet’s proper function.

Toilet Valve Replacement Questions
What is a toilet valve replacement? It involves removing the old or faulty valve inside the toilet tank and installing a new one to ensure proper flushing and water control.
When should a toilet valve be replaced? Replacement is needed if the toilet runs continuously, leaks, or if flushing becomes inconsistent or ineffective.
Are there different types of toilet valves? Yes, common types include fill valves and flush valves, each designed for specific functions within the toilet tank.
What are signs that indicate a valve replacement is necessary? Signs include constant running water, frequent leaks, or difficulty flushing that doesn't improve after adjustments.
